详细内容或原文请订阅后点击阅览
AI驱动的编码的兴起:效率还是网络安全噩梦?
AI驱动的编码工具正在更改软件开发范式。 Github Copilot,Amazon Codewhisperer和Chatgpt等平台对于开发人员来说已经至关重要,帮助他们更快地编写代码,有效地调试代码,并以最小的努力来处理复杂的编程任务。这些由AI驱动的编码助手可以自动化繁琐的任务,提供实时调试,并帮助解决复杂的问题,仅[…] AI驱动的编码的兴起:效率或网络安全噩梦?首先出现在unite.ai上。
来源:Unite.AIAI驱动的编码工具正在更改软件开发范式。 Github Copilot,Amazon Codewhisperer和Chatgpt等平台对于开发人员来说已经至关重要,帮助他们更快地编写代码,有效地调试代码,并以最小的努力来处理复杂的编程任务。这些AI驱动的编码助手可以自动化繁琐的任务,提供实时调试,并仅通过一些建议帮助解决复杂的问题。他们承诺提高生产率和自动化,从而减少重复编码任务的需求。
AI驱动的编码 软件开发 github copilot Amazon Codewhisperer但是,与这些好处一起是一组复杂的风险。网络安全威胁,过度依赖人工智能的潜力以及对工作流离失所的担忧都是不容忽视的严重问题。虽然AI编码工具可能是一个很大的帮助,但必须查看好处和缺点,以了解它们是否真正改善软件开发或创造新问题。
AI如何转换软件开发
AI逐渐成为软件开发的重要组成部分,从处理语法校正和自动形成的简单工具转变为能够生成整个代码块的高级系统。最初,AI工具用于诸如语法校正,自动形式和基本代码建议之类的次要任务。开发人员将AI用于重构和检查常见错误等任务,这有助于简化开发过程。当AI超越基本帮助并开始生成完整的代码块,识别复杂的逻辑错误并推荐应用程序结构时,它的完整功能变得显而易见。
此外,AI生成的代码可以引入安全漏洞,例如较弱的身份验证机制,处理不当的用户输入以及暴露于注射攻击,使网络安全风险成为人们严重依赖AI驱动开发工具的组织的越来越关注。
github报告